Abstract
A hydraulic drive system is provided and generally includes a first rotor assembly arranged along a first side of the frame and having a first rotor and a first drive shaft extending through and connectable with the first rotor, a first motor assembly disposed along the first side of the frame and positioned linearly the first rotor assembly and a second rotor assembly arranged along a second side of the frame that is opposite the first side and having a second rotor and a second drive shaft extending through and connectable with the second rotor.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A trailer, comprising:
a frame with a pair of drive wheels positioned on opposite sides thereof; and a hydraulic drive system attached to an underside of the frame, the hydraulic drive system having:
a first rotor assembly arranged along a first side of the frame and having a first rotor and a first drive shaft extending through and connectable with the first rotor;
a first motor assembly disposed along the first side of the frame and positioned linearly the first rotor assembly and having a first motor actuator;
a first lever assembly to reversibly engage and disengage the motor actuator with the first drive shaft;
a first drive wheel of the pair of drive wheels connected to the first rotor;
a second rotor assembly arranged along a second side of the frame that is opposite the first side and having a second rotor and a second drive shaft extending through and connectable with the second rotor;
a second motor assembly disposed along the second side of the frame and positioned linearly the second rotor assembly and having a second motor actuator;
a second lever assembly to reversibly engage and disengage the motor actuator with the first drive shaft, the second lever assembly independent of the first lever assembly; and
a second drive wheel of the pair of drive wheels connected to the second rotor.
2 . The trailer of claim 1 , further comprising an engagement assembly moving the first motor actuator toward and away from the first rotor assembly to respectively engage and disengage therewith and moving the second motor actuator toward and away from the second rotor assembly to respectively engage and disengage therewith.
3 . The trailer of claim 1 , wherein the first motor actuator includes a plurality of motor actuator teeth disposed on an end thereof.
4 . The trailer of claim 3 , wherein the first rotor actuator includes a plurality of rotor actuator teeth disposed on an end.
5 . The trailer of claim 4 , wherein the plurality of motor actuator teeth correspond with and separated from the plurality of rotor actuator teeth when positioned in a disengagement position.
6 . The trailer of claim 5 , wherein the plurality of motor actuator teeth correspond with and engage the plurality of rotor actuator teeth when positioned in an engagement position.
7 . The trailer of claim 1 , wherein the first hydraulic motor is connected to a planetary gear drive by a motor shaft extends from the hydraulic motor and into the planetary gear drive.
8 . The trailer of claim 7 , wherein the first hydraulic motor operates the planetary gear drive.
9 . The trailer of claim 8 , wherein the first motor actuator is positioned on an opposite side of the planetary gear drive with respect to the hydraulic motor.
10 . The trailer of claim 9 , wherein the first rotor actuator is positioned in a bell housing of the first rotor assembly.
11 . The trailer of claim 10 , wherein the first rotor actuator includes a rotor actuator spline engaged with the first drive shaft such that rotation of the first rotor actuator imparts rotation to the first drive shaft.
12 . The trailer of claim 11 , wherein the first drive shaft is secured to a hub housing fixed to the first rotor.Cited by (0)
